This is indeed a freeze, not a crash. It's a weird situation where you get a backtrace so it *looks* like a crash, but the crash is a secondary effect that is caused by the system being frozen, if that makes sense. In a Fedora bug [1], the use of intel-gpu-tools to collect a ring/batch- buffer dump was suggested when this crash occurs. That package seems to be installed by default on Lucid.
